Summer of Gaming Event will Include Blizzard

With no E3 this year and other industry events canned due to COVID-19, other arrangements have been made. One of the events to take place is IGN’s Summer of Gaming. Blizzard is to make an appearance.

Summer of Gaming will take place in June alongside the other main event organised by The Guerilla Collective. Yesterday an indie event called Indie Live was also announced. These events all take place at the start of June and viewers itching for some gaming news and reveals.

Blizzard is just the latest edition to the IGN event but there’s no details on what will be shown or possibly revealed. Considering Blizzard usually misses E3 this can is a bonus so early in the year. Perhaps they are airing on the side of caution in case they have to cancel BlizzCon later this year.

It would be jumping the gun to expect a Diablo 2 Resurrected announcement if that is actually a thing. We can only speculate at the moment but they’ll likely show off some WoW stuff an maybe even Overwatch 2. Stay tuned for more as June gets closer.

IGN is proud to announce our new Summer of Gaming event, a global, digital event set to begin this June to bring you the latest news and impressions around upcoming games and the next generation of console hardware.

IGN will be collaborating with a number of partners for the Summer of Gaming, including 2K, Square Enix, SEGA, Bandai Namco, Amazon, Google Stadia, Twitter, Devolver Digital, THQ Nordic, and more. Expect more details in the coming weeks. The event will include live broadcasts and on-demand programming featuring IGN’s editorial coverage of the work of game developers from around the world.
